Southwest Bedroom Decor Ideas
The Southwest style is a blend of Native American, Mexican, and Spanish influences. It is characterized by its warm colors, natural materials, and unique patterns. If you're looking to create a Southwest-inspired bedroom, there are a few key elements to keep in mind.
Colors
The colors of the Southwest are typically warm and earthy, such as terracotta, turquoise, ochre, and sage green. These colors can be used on the walls, bedding, and furniture. You can also add pops of brighter colors, such as red or orange, to create a more vibrant look.
Materials
Natural materials are essential to the Southwest style. Wood, leather, and stone are all popular choices for furniture and decor. You can also use textiles made from natural fibers, such as cotton, wool, and linen.
Patterns
Geometric patterns are commonly used in Southwest decor. These patterns can be found on textiles, rugs, and even walls. Some of the most popular geometric patterns include stripes, chevrons, and zigzags. You can also find more organic patterns, such as floral and animal prints.
Furniture
The furniture in a Southwest bedroom should be comfortable and inviting. Overstuffed chairs and sofas are popular choices, as are beds with upholstered headboards. You can also add a few rustic pieces, such as a wooden chest or a leather ottoman.
Accessories
The right accessories can help to complete the look of a Southwest bedroom. Some popular accessories include pottery, baskets, and Native American textiles. You can also add a few pieces of Southwestern art, such as a painting or a sculpture. By following these tips, you can create a Southwest-inspired bedroom that is both stylish and inviting.
Here are some additional tips for creating a Southwest bedroom:
- Use natural light to your advantage. The Southwest is known for its sunshine, so make sure to open up your windows and let the light in.
- Add some plants to your bedroom. Plants can help to create a more natural and inviting atmosphere.
- Hang some dream catchers. Dream catchers are a traditional Native American symbol of protection. They are believed to ward off bad dreams and bring good luck.
